Composition of Weekly Frequencies on Eastbound Transatlantic Nonstop Routes

The predominant type of aircraft in the transatlantic market is the widebody twin � a twin-aisle widebody aircraft with two engines. Such aircraft are more fuel efficient than three- and four-engine airlines like the MD-11 and Boeing 747 and their moderate capacity is better suited to the proliferation of �pencil routes�.
